Plateform independance seems a very good idea.
but i have some questions (i have tons of questions ;-)
i tried various sizes for the -M parameter and it seems to have nearly no
effect on the speed of the engine while the param is in the range 1 -> 512
(little slow down for huge cache)
i tried very small size 0.1 , 0.01 and 0.001
there is a significant slowdown for 0.001 (twice slower) but nothing terrible
for 0.1 or 0.01
Here is my question :
in genmove, at each move during initialisation, there is a call to
reset_engine()
and it seems that it clears everything , so the cache is only used during one
"move generation", and does not survive once the move is played.
i naively thought that the cache would persist during all the game.
Am i correct, or did i miss some important thing ?
(i searched in the documentation but did not found this kind of explainations)
$time gnugo -M 0.001 --replay white -l /Big/GO/new-tests/c-61.sgf
57s
$time gnugo -M 0.01 --replay white -l /Big/GO/new-tests/c-61.sgf
34s
$time gnugo -M 100 --replay white -l /Big/GO/new-tests/c-61.sgf
34s
